c7dffce81e Serve an uploaded file as data, not as a document that can run
An SVG is an XML document that may carry a script, and it is an accepted image
type because floor-plan maps and branding genuinely want vector. Loaded through
an img tag that script never runs, so the tiles and maps were never the risk.
Opening the file's own URL is - and the application image route is public, so
that URL needs no session.

Every route that serves an upload now goes through one helper that sends
Content-Security-Policy: default-src 'none'; sandbox, and nosniff. Seven routes
across core and five plugins, so a new one added later starts from the same
place rather than repeating the reasoning. Banning the format instead would
have cost the maps their only sensible one.

The app also sent no security headers at all. It now sets nosniff,
frame-ancestors self (as X-Frame-Options too, for the display bays' browsers)
and a referrer policy. Deliberately NOT a page-wide CSP: this serves an SPA with
inline styles, so a real script-src policy is a change worth making with the
frontend in front of you, and a permissive header claiming one would be worse
than having none.

Contract 0.19.0. send_upload is on the shopdb.api surface, because a plugin
serving user-supplied bytes should not have to remember these headers. The same
bump records that get_dashboard_widgets has taken data and shape rather than a
component name since the dashboard was rebuilt - that shipped without a bump,
while BasePlugin and PLUGIN-HOOKS.md both still documented the shape nothing
renders, which is how five plugins came to declare widgets pointing at
components nobody had written.

75386d2f51 geenforce: resource-scope binding for fetch tokens (0.15.0)
A geenforce.fetch token can now be pinned to specific manifest scopes so a
fleet-wide key (a display's, delivered by DSC or baked into the image) is not a
skeleton key for the whole content store. NULL binding = unrestricted, so every
existing service token keeps working.

Core:
- ApiToken.resourcescopes column + resourcescopelist property (migration
  7d30_apitoken_resourcescopes; NULL = unrestricted).
- apitokens API create/update accept + persist an optional resourcescopes list
  (a resource-name allowlist; not permission-catalog names).
- New contract helper authorized_service_token(scope): same check as
  service_token_authorized but returns the ApiToken so a plugin can read its
  binding. Contract 0.14.0 -> 0.15.0; also export SupportTeam.

GE-Enforce enforcement:
- get_manifest: a bound token requesting a scope outside its allowlist -> 403.
- get_payload: a bound token may only pull a blob its own scope(s) reference
  (service.blob_referenced_by_scopes); anything else -> 404 (no hash probing).
- Decorator stashes the authorized token on g for the route to read.

Also fixes a pre-existing contract-surface violation: the printers/printedparts
alert helpers imported shopdb.core.models / shopdb.extensions directly; now
via shopdb.api (SupportTeam newly exported). Docs: GE-ENFORCE-DISPLAY.md
provisioning note, PLUGIN-HOOKS.md, CLAUDE.md.

9 new resource-binding tests; full suite 1131 passing.

Contract 0.12.0: send_email/send_alert join the plugin surface (the
mailer was core-only), PLUGIN-HOOKS and status docs updated, manifest
pins the new floor. The alert fires inside _ledger_write only when a
decrement CROSSES the item's threshold - one alert per depletion,
rearmed by restocking above - and is best-effort after the commit so
mail trouble can never fail a take. Recipients come from
printedparts_alert_email, falling back to the site alert_recipients.
on_enable re-seeds settings idempotently so existing installs pick up
new keys. Crossing/rearm semantics proven by test.

Badge resolver copied from the USB contract (SSO digits, 0<digits>BZ
PayNo wrap) with names from the employees directory and the
unknown-badge policy setting; deliberately copied rather than
cross-imported so the contract test stays green. Restock and adjust
write the ledger row and move the cached quantity in one commit -
the single-commit invariant every write path must use. Adjust
requires a reason and refuses to drive stock below zero. Detail page
gains Restock/Adjust modals. Seven tests cover minting, the
cache==ledger invariant, badge shapes, policy toggle, and auth.
